Transportation Strategies

Transportation strategies in military emergency logistics response encompass methods and systems designed to ensure the rapid and efficient movement of personnel, equipment, and supplies during crises. Effective transportation is vital for maintaining operational readiness and supporting mission objectives.

The integration of multiple transport modalities, such as air, land, and sea, is fundamental. For instance, air transport enables quick deployment to remote or contested areas, while ground logistics can facilitate sustained operations in established theaters. Each modality has its strengths, and the choice often depends on the urgency, geography, and nature of the response.

Coordination among various transportation assets is essential. Real-time tracking and route optimization enable military planners to adjust plans dynamically, addressing unforeseen challenges like adverse weather or enemy activity. Employing specialized vehicles designed for specific terrains enhances operational efficacy in diverse environments.

Ultimately, successful transportation strategies in emergency logistics response hinge on adaptability and preparedness. Well-defined protocols and trained personnel ensure that logistics operations can scale effectively, facilitating timely support in crisis situations and underscoring the significance of robust military logistics infrastructure.

Types of Emergency Logistics Response Operations

Emergency logistics response operations encompass a range of structured actions aimed at addressing the unique challenges posed by crises in military contexts. These operations can be categorized into various types, each tailored to specific scenarios and objectives.

One prominent type is humanitarian assistance, which involves the deployment of resources, personnel, and supplies to support civilian populations affected by natural disasters or humanitarian crises. This operation ensures rapid delivery of essential commodities, such as food, water, and medical aid, often necessitating coordination across multiple agencies.

Another type is disaster relief logistics, focused on managing the influx of goods and services to affected areas during emergencies. This includes establishing temporary supply chains, utilizing forward operating bases, and implementing effective distribution strategies to ensure that crucial resources arrive at the right time and location.

Finally, combat logistics operations are crucial in conflict scenarios, providing necessary support to military forces. This can involve transportation of troops, munitions, and medical provisions, ensuring operational readiness during critical missions. In each type, effective emergency logistics response is fundamental to achieving mission success.

Case Studies of Successful Emergency Logistics Response

One notable case study highlighting effective Emergency Logistics Response in a military context is the United States military’s operation during Hurricane Katrina in 2005. The prompt deployment of logistics personnel and resources significantly impacted relief efforts, showcasing the importance of rapid response capabilities. This operation involved extensive coordination among various military branches, demonstrating a well-structured emergency logistics framework.

Another key example is Operation United Assistance in 2014, where the U.S. military was tasked with addressing the Ebola outbreak in West Africa. The military established airlift capabilities, efficient supply chains, and medical logistics support, effectively limiting the outbreak’s spread. Collaboration with international organizations emphasized the critical role of strategic partnerships in emergency logistics response.

The NATO-led response to the 2010 Haiti earthquake further exemplifies successful emergency logistics. The swift deployment of logistics units ensured timely delivery of essential supplies. Utilizing aerial transportation and ground vehicles, this operation highlighted the significance of adaptability and communication during crises. These case studies collectively underscore the effectiveness of Emergency Logistics Response in addressing urgent challenges within a military framework.
